Insurance Product Analyst

Remote · USA Full-time New today

Position Overview: We are seeking a highly skilled and analytical Insurance Product Analyst to join our team. The successful candidate will be responsible for developing insurance products, overseeing the implementation of product changes, and driving product performance to achieve our company’s strategic goals. The ideal candidate should have a thorough understanding of insurance products, market dynamics, and consumer insights. They should also have excellent problem-solving skills and a strong ability to think strategically and analytically about business, product, and technical challenges. Key Responsibilities: Provide information to leadership/management that will affect profit and growth plan execution on an ongoing basis. Develop reports, analysis, or recommended strategies related to product development or enhancement, product language, underwriting guidelines, processes, and agent business practices. Analyze information and present opportunities to improve product or business practices and procedures. Monitor effectiveness of current products and recommend changes and/or enhancements to management. Analyze information and/or data in support of the formulation and execution of operational plans. May specialize in supporting policy forms development and implementation Research philosophies and strategies that support growth and long-term profitability goals. Qualifications: Minimum of three years experience as a successful Insurance Product Analyst or similar role in P&C Insurance industry Knowledge of insurance products, policy forms, underwriting, pricing and product development. Familiarity with Excess & Surplus Lines markets is a plus Strong time management skills BSc/BA in Business Administration, Insurance, Mathematics, Statistics or relevant field
